We got Grave of the Fireflies solicited by Sentai Filmworks today. Plus Japan solicited Kiki's Delivery Service and Only Yesterday.

That leaves these Ghibli releases unreleased in Japan. It would not surprised me if all of them (not too sure about Ocean Waves) gets Blu-ray releases in Japan next year. If that happens, U.S. will be even further behind on these BD releases.
  • Porco Rosso (1992)
  • Ocean Waves (Special) (1993)
  • Pom Poko (1994)
  • Princess Mononoke (1997)
  • Spirited Away (2001)
  • The Cat Returns (2002)

With the latest pairing (Howl's Moving Castle and My Neighbor Totoro), the only other Ghibli release slated for Fall 2013 is From Up on Poppy Hill (via GKids, distributed by New Video Group).

Looking further ahead for 2014 (unless Disney magically speeds their releases up), the possible pairing could be Kiki's Delivery Service and Tales From Earthsea. It's not looking very good for My Neighbors the Yamadas. And after that there is Only Yesterday...we know Disney won't be touching that.

So as of right now we are four titles behind Japan. But when 2013 is over, we will be further behind once again. It will be interesting to see what gets released (from below) in Japan.
  • Porco Rosso (1992)
  • Ocean Waves (Special) (1993)
  • Pom Poko (1994)
  • Princess Mononoke (1997)
  • Spirited Away (2001)
  • The Cat Returns (2002)

via Blu-ray.com forums - someone asked GKids about Only Yesterday and its home video possibility.
Quote:
Disney does not own home video rights to Only Yesterday. Studio Ghibli has them, and it will eventually see the light of day in North America.
